Movie mogul Harvey Weinstein’s defense team have again — unsuccessfully — sought to have a juror removed because of her reading material.

The juror recently posted on a book review site that she was reading My Dark Vanessa and Le Consentement, both of which center on predatory sexual relationships between older men and teenage girls.

Weinstein, of course, is on trial for rape and sexual assault; his lawyers argued Tuesday that such reading material violated juror instructions not to “consume media related to the trial,” according to Vulture.

The judge asked the juror a few questions Tuesday, concluded it wasn’t an issue, and reaffirmed his belief when Weinstein’s lawyers again called the reading material into question today.
